Output 14038ed30237674557fc0c155aebe9221b340359ff72f3902c0341f4c6db2965:4

value
335564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d99bd9c5097bc68028cbd71a978c03a584f9dcf2 OP_EQUAL
address
3MXdFs7bSUCNyByGcFQU1MoZhgdeA4wHkq
transaction
14038ed30237674557fc0c155aebe9221b340359ff72f3902c0341f4c6db2965
spent
true